Breaks Interstate Park
Nature reserve
Photo: SheepNotGoats,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Breaks Interstate Park, also known as "the Breaks," is a bi-state state park located partly in southeastern Kentucky and southwestern Virginia in the Jefferson National Forest, at the northeastern terminus of Pine Mountain. Breaks Interstate Park is situated 1½ miles southeast of Pool Point Bridge.

Elkhorn City
Town
Photo: Nyttend, Public domain.
Elkhorn City is a home rule-class city in Pike County, Kentucky, in the United States. The population was 1,035 at the 2020 census. The city is located in proximity to the Breaks Interstate Park. Elkhorn City is situated 1½ miles northwest of Pool Point Bridge.
